Transportation Information
Modern units with air-conditioning and heating provide the transportation for this tour.
Pickup from most downtown hotels in Mendoza ensures convenient access. For accommodations outside the urban radius, the nearest meeting point will be provided.
Regular excursions may take 30 to 35 minutes for pickups, and delays are possible due to multiple stops.
This efficient transportation allows participants to focus on the stunning natural scenery of the Atuel Canyon during the full-day tour.

Exploring the Picturesque Atuel Canyon
Nestled in the heart of the Argentinian Andes, the Atuel Canyon beckons adventurers with its awe-inspiring landscapes.
Carved by the Atuel River, the canyon’s dramatic rock formations and vibrant hues create a stunning natural spectacle. Visitors can hike along scenic trails, admire breathtaking vistas, and enjoy the region’s rich geology and wildlife.
The full-day tour offers ample time to explore the canyon’s diverse attractions, from glistening waterfalls to hidden caves.
With knowledgeable guides and comfortable transportation, travelers can discover the rugged beauty of this remarkable natural wonder at their own pace.
